What is provided and what to bring:  

We provide the bowls, water bucket, blankets.  Regarding food…we suggest that you bring the food your fur baby has been eating so that they do not get an upset tummy from an abrupt change in diet coupled with their new surroundings.  If your fur baby has the proverbial cast iron stomach and can eat most anything then we will gladly provide the food. If you bring a favorite toy, blanket or other procession we ask that you do not bring an expensive item.  Toys can get lost to other dogs when left in a play yard and blankets don’t always come back in the condition they came in. All dry food should be provided in resealable containers (no large opened bags please). All pill form medications should be provided in a pill box and not in the original packaging.
